Changed defaults in Splitfork, our assignment service. Bucketing now uses sticky hashing per account instead of per session, and the holdout slice grew from 2% to 5%. Callers relying on session-level reassignment must opt in explicitly. Review the diff against the new baseline; the updated default configuration is listed below.

config for tagep-kajof:
[casir]
port = 6379
region = south-1
host = casir.paliqdyn.example
team = tamax
timeout_ms = 250
retries = 2

## Deploying the Gatewick Proctor Queue

Deploys are pretty painless: push to main, wait for the pipeline, then watch the queue drain dashboard for five minutes. If candidates pile up mid-exam, roll back first and ask questions later — the queue replays safely. Everything the workers care about lives in one config block, shown here for reference.

settings of bafof-yagef:
JOROX_PIN=8740
JOROX_TENANT=pelox
JOROX_METRICS_HOST=metrics.jorox.qorvelworks.internal
JOROX_SEAL=seal_c78f63c1
JOROX_STANDBY_TEAM=norax

## Workshop Access — Building C

The Fabrix prototype workshop (Building C, ground floor) is restricted. No visitors without a Helvane Labs escort. Steel-toe shoes required past the yellow line. Reception signs in workshop guests, issues orange lanyards, and logs tool-crib loans. After 18:00, the roller door locks automatically; use the side entrance only. Report faulty sensors to the facilities desk before opening the space. The keypad beside the side entrance accepts the following staff pass code.

turnstile pass: bdg-R-53

Subject: Pixelmill CLI cut-over complete

Hi all — the cut-over of the Pixelmill batch resizer to the new worker pool finished last night. Plugin hooks now fire once per batch rather than per image, so authors relying on per-file callbacks should switch to the manifest iterator. Legacy hooks will keep working until the next minor release, with a deprecation warning. The production service is now running with the following configuration:

service settings:
PRAIX_LOG_LEVEL=error
PRAIX_METRICS_HOST=metrics.praix.qorvelcorp.corp
PRAIX_POOL_SIZE=16